Smart home devices come in different forms. Some focus on entertainment, while others improve security or convenience.
| Model | Price (Approx) | Specifications | Why It Is Recommended |
|---|---|---|---|
| Philips Hue Bridge Smart Light | Rs. 5,999 | Smart Lighting Control, App Support, Voice Assistant Compatibility | Makes lighting easier to control and customize |
| Amazon Echo Dot (5th Gen) | Rs. 5,499 | Alexa Voice Assistant, Bluetooth Speaker, Smart Home Hub | Works as the control center for many smart devices |
| Amazon Fire TV Stick HD | Rs. 3,999 | HD Streaming, Alexa Voice Remote, Smart TV Features | Adds smart features to almost any TV |
| CHAMBERLAIN Smart Garage Control | Rs. 4,999 | Remote Garage Access, Smartphone Monitoring | Adds convenience and security |
| Smart Plug Mini HomeKit | Rs. 2,499 | Remote Device Control, Scheduling, Voice Support | Converts regular appliances into smart devices |
| Google Nest Thermostat | Rs. 11,999 | Smart Temperature Control, Energy Monitoring, Mobile App Support | Helps maintain comfort and save energy |
| Qubo Smart 360° 3MP CCTV Camera | Rs. 2,990 | 360° Coverage, Motion Detection, Two-Way Audio | Useful for home monitoring and security |
| Bose New Smart Ultra Soundbar with Dolby Atmos Plus Alexa | Rs. 89,900 | Dolby Atmos Audio, Alexa Built-In, Premium Sound | Delivers an excellent home entertainment experience |
| Sony 108 cm (43 Inches) BRAVIA 2M2 Series | Rs. 42,990 | 4K Display, Google TV, Voice Control | Great for movies, sports, and streaming |
| Daikin 1.5 Ton 3 Star Inverter Split AC | Rs. 39,990 | Inverter Compressor, Smart Controls, Efficient Cooling | Offers comfort with connected controls |

The selection process is the toughest. The first thing to consider before investing is what you need the gadget for. If you’re looking for convenience, a smart plug is probably the best option. Otherwise, you can even consider a smart speaker. Both are great for convenience.
If the priority involves security, a smart camera is something you should consider first. For entertainment, a smart TV or soundbar can greatly enhance the experience.
The next thing to verify is compatibility. Before you spend thousands on a smart gadget, you must ensure it is compatible with the existing ones, most importantly, with voice assistants. It is also worthwhile to consider features, ease of setup, and long-term support before buying.

Which smart home device is best for beginners?
Ans: The Amazon Echo Dot (5th Gen) is one of the easiest smart home devices to start with. It is simple to set up and supports many connected gadgets.
Do smart home devices save electricity?
Ans: Some devices can help reduce energy use. Smart thermostats, smart lights, and smart plugs allow users to manage power consumption more efficiently.
Can smart home devices work together?
Ans: Yes. Many smart home products can connect through platforms such as Alexa, Google Home, and Apple HomeKit for easier control.
Is a smart camera useful for home security?
Ans: Yes. Smart cameras provide live monitoring, motion alerts, and remote access, helping users keep track of their property from anywhere.
What should buyers check before purchasing a smart home device?
Ans: Buyers should compare compatibility, features, ease of use, app support, warranty coverage, and overall value before choosing a smart home product.
